Pivotal in terms of defining the parameters of the arab-israeli conflict. Took on some key cold war characteristics. Early israeli-arab negotiations: armistice agreements after 1948 war left israel and arab states technically in a state of war. Conditions at the end of the 1948 wars - arab states except iraq signed armistice agreements: declaration that war came to an end. Arab states remained in a state of war poised to return to combat. Preserving israel"s borders, not giving up territory. 700,000 palestinians have left or became refugees through the war. Israeli leadership wanted to cement a kind of permanent jewish majority. Wanted israel to be jewish and democratic. Operate according to the norms of western electoral democracy: 1949: un sponsored negotiations between israel and arab states at lausanne went nowhere. Could not find a common ground that would lead to fruitful negotiations.
